What Affects Patent Filing Cost in Providence?

Patent Type

Provisional (placeholder): $1,500-$5,000. Design: $2,000-$5,000. Utility (simple): $7,000-$12,000. Utility (complex): $12,000-$25,000+

Attorney Fees

Patent agent: $3,000-$8,000. Small firm: $5,000-$15,000. Large firm: $10,000-$25,000+

USPTO Fees

Micro entity: $400-$1,000. Small entity: $800-$2,000. Large entity: $1,600-$4,000

Tips to Save on Patent Filing in Providence

  • 1.Start with a provisional patent ($1,500-$5,000) to establish your filing date while spending a year developing the full application
  • 2.Micro entity status (income under $229,269) cuts USPTO fees by 80%. Small entity saves 60%
  • 3.Design patents ($2,000-$5,000 total) are faster and cheaper than utility patents
  • 4.Consider patent prosecution through a registered agent instead of a large law firm (save 30-50%)

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does the patent process take?

Provisional patent: filed immediately (valid 12 months). Design patent: 12-24 months to issue. Utility patent: 18-36 months average (can take 5+ years). Expedited examination ($2,000-$4,000 extra) can reduce to 6-12 months.

Is a patent worth the cost?

It depends on the commercial potential. A patent is worth it if: your invention has significant market value, competitors could copy it, or you plan to license it. Many patents are never commercialized. Consider the total cost ($5,000-$20,000+) vs potential revenue.
